Preconstruction Phase
Schedule, cost, quality, and communication control are our focus throughout our projects beginning at the earliest stages. Time is money and there is none of either to waste. Time delays are the biggest contributor to increased cost on construction projects. Successful projects begin controlling time from the outset, long before the project scope is fully defined. One of our first efforts is to develop a conceptual master schedule in concert with a conceptual budget estimate.
Throughout schematic design, design development, and the construction document phases, our construction managers work closely with the owner's project team to refine the project schedule and budget in more detail as the scope of the project is further refined.
C&S implements design and constructability reviews during the design phase to help control quality, cost, and schedule. We use the contractor's perspective and our full in-house design capacity to provide the most efficient and cost-effective input to your design team. Feedback on phasing, methods, materials and specifications, contract packaging, and contract administration minimizes construction impacts.
Our construction managers should also be actively involved before and during the bidding process. We help develop the bidding documents and related project requirements, including the specification language regarding site logistics, rules of engagement, and procedures for the project. We also help generate contractor interest in your project and facilitate the flow of bidding information to ensure the best possible bidding environment for your project. We also assist with review of the bids and recommendations for contract award.
